4 Crops that Easily Grow Indoors for Winter Salad Greens: Growth Examples, Planting, & Basic Lights

I enjoy growing peas, spinach, arugula, and radishes indoors for winter greens. You just need basic while LED shop lights. I show you how they grow and how to plant and care for them.
